    TV Settings Menu Picture Picture Mode Sets a picture mode when displaying an input other than a PC. The options for “Picture Mode” may differ depending on the “Video/Photo” setting (page 28). Vivid Enhances picture contrast and sharpness. Standard For standard pictures. Recommended for home entertainment.

    Colour System Selects the colour system (“Auto”, “PAL”, “SECAM”) according to the channel. Signal Level Displays the signal level for programme currently being watched. Digital Set-up Digital Tuning Digital Auto Tunes in the available digital channels. Tuning You can retune the TV after moving house, or to search for newly launched channels.
  • Page 34 Optical Out Selects the audio signal that is output from the DIGITAL AUDIO OUT (OPTICAL) terminal on the rear of the TV. Set to “Auto” when equipment compatible with Dolby Digital is connected, and set to “PCM” when noncompatible equipment is connected.
